National Healthcare Decisions Day Workshop Set for April 16 at United Church Ludlow

The United Church of Ludlow along with other national, state and community organizations, are leading a massive effort to highlight the importance of advance healthcare decision-making—an effort that has culminated in the formal designation of April 16 as National Healthcare Decisions Day (NHDD). As a participating organization, the United Church is providing information and tools for the public to talk about their wishes with family and friends, and execute written advance directives (healthcare power of attorney and living will) in accordance with Vermont state laws.

Specifically, on Tuesday, April 16, at 10:00 AM and 7:00 PM, the United Church is welcoming the public at the corner of Elm and Pleasant Streets in Ludlow with free information about advance care planning and advance directive forms. The workshops feature video case studies that spark discussion of the reasons for and means of preparing and filing healthcare advance directives specifically in Vermont. There will be opportunity to complete directives at the workshop. 

“As a result of National Healthcare Decisions Day, many more people in our community can be expected to have thoughtful conversations about their healthcare decisions and complete reliable advance directives to make their wishes known,” said Bob Kottkamp, President of the United Church  “Fewer families and healthcare providers will have to struggle with making difficult healthcare decisions in the absence of guidance from the patient, and healthcare providers and facilities will be better equipped to address advance healthcare planning issues before a crisis and be better able to honor patient wishes when the time comes to do so.”
